    Hi there! Congrats on taking your first step to becoming a healthier you!
    My surgery is scheduled for 1/25/17. I would first suggest finding out if your insurance company covers bariatric surgery at all, as some do not. Most insurance companies require 3-12 months of medically supervised diet/nutritional counseling, as well as a BMI of 40+ or 35 and at least 2 co-morbidities. I switched insurance mid-process, but both BC/BS and United Healthcare required 6 months. I attended an introductory seminar, 6 month nutritional counseling, and 2 support groups. Your insurance/physician may require additional testing like a sleep study, EKG, etc, as well as psychological clearance. It seems like a lot but I completed it quickly.

    The easy answer is this:
    When you stop doing what worked before, it doesn't work anymore.
    When you stop:
    Eating Protein first
    Drinking at least 64 oz of no calorie, low calorie fluids
    Limiting sugar, white carbohydrates, and calorie laden drinks
    Moving more than sitting
    Not drinking with meals
    Eating mostly fresh, non processed food
    Eating tons of colored veggies
    Weighing yourself to hold yourself accountable
    you will gain.
    Pretty much it in a nutshell.
